Weβve signed an agreement with Bollinger Shipyards to complete the build-out of our 400ft landing platform for Neutron missions that return to Earth at sea β expanding our development of Neutron recovery infrastructure to Louisiana β π Learn more: bit.ly/4lxFwMs

A look at the barge Oceanus, which Rocket Lab has acquired for conversion into a landing platform for the Neutron rocket.
Built in 2010 and 400ft long x 105ft wide, the barge is slightly longer than Blue Origin's Jacklyn, both outclassing SpaceX's trio of 300ft long droneships.
